Ardissonea crystallina var. bacillarls (Grunow) Grunow 1880

Publication Details
Ardissonea crystallina var. bacillarls (Grunow) Grunow 1880: 108

Published in: Cleve, P.T. & Grunow, A. (1880). Beiträge zur Kenntniss der arctischen Diatomeen. Kongliga Svenska Vetenskaps-Akademiens Handlingar 17(2): 1-121, 7 pls.

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Ardissonea is Ardissonea robusta (Ralfs) De Notaris.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Grunowago bacillaris (Grunow) Lobban & Ashworth.

Basionym
Synedra crystallina var. bacillaris Grunow

Type Information
Type locality: Honduras; (Grunow 1877: 167) Notes: Lobban & al. (2022: fig. 19 A-G) illustrate "putative" material "from Grunow’s Honduras material".

Origin of Species Name
Adjective (Latin), crystalline.

General Environment
This is a marine species.
